Cerebellum Gene Expression Correlates for COCA_TIME_PCT_CHANGE measured in BXD RI Females obtained using SJUT Cerebellum mRNA M430 (Mar05) RMA. The COCA_TIME_PCT_CHANGE measures Cocaine CPP - difference in percent test time spent relative to preconditioning under the domain Cocaine. The correlates were thresholded at a p-value of less than 0.001.

"Combining with a purine nucleotide and transmitting the signal across the membrane by activating an associated G-protein; promotes the exchange of GDP for GTP on the alpha subunit of a heterotrimeric G-protein complex." [GOC:mah, PMID:9755289]
"The series of molecular signals generated as a consequence of a receptor binding to an extracellular purine or purine derivative and transmitting the signal to a heterotrimeric G-protein complex to initiate a change in cell activity." [GOC:BHF, PMID:9755289]
"Combining with a purine nucleotide and transmitting the signal from one side of the membrane to the other to initiate a change in cell activity." [GOC:mah, GOC:signaling]
"The series of molecular signals generated as a consequence of a receptor binding to an extracellular purine nucleotide and transmitting the signal to a heterotrimeric G-protein complex to initiate a change in cell activity." [GOC:BHF, PMID:9755289]
"Combining with a nucleotide and transmitting the signal across the membrane by activating an associated G-protein; promotes the exchange of GDP for GTP on the alpha subunit of a heterotrimeric G-protein complex." [GOC:bf, GOC:dph, IUPHAR_GPCR:1294]
"Combining with a nucleotide and transmitting the signal from one side of the membrane to the other to initiate a change in cell activity. A nucleotide is a compound that consists of a nucleoside esterified with a phosphate molecule." [GOC:signaling, ISBN:0198506732]
